This allows a LayoutChild to have layout performed on it, which will return a Fragment - with the correct inline and block sizes. These Fragments cannot be positioned yet, (next patch). The LayoutChild will be laid out with an available inline/block size of zero by default, and optionally can accept a fixed-inline/block size, which it must respect. gamepad.idl
interface Gamepad {
readonly attribute DOMString id;
readonly attribute long index;
readonly attribute boolean connected;
readonly attribute DOMHighResTimeStamp timestamp;
readonly attribute GamepadMappingType mapping;
readonly attribute FrozenArray<double> axes;
readonly attribute FrozenArray<GamepadButton> buttons;
};
interface GamepadButton {
readonly attribute boolean pressed;
readonly attribute boolean touched;
readonly attribute double value;
};
enum GamepadMappingType {
"",
"standard",
};
partial interface Navigator {
sequence<Gamepad?> getGamepads();
};
[Constructor(GamepadEventInit eventInitDict)]
interface GamepadEvent : Event {
readonly attribute Gamepad gamepad;
};
dictionary GamepadEventInit : EventInit {
required Gamepad gamepad;
};
